# §2163. Reservation of territorial power to control territory and territorial instrumentalities


Subject to the limitations set forth in subchapters I and II of this chapter, this subchapter does not limit or impair the power of a [covered territory](/usc/48/2104.md?p=8) to control, by legislation or otherwise, the [territory](/usc/48/2104.md?p=20) or any [territorial instrumentality](/usc/48/2104.md?p=19-A) thereof in the exercise of the political or governmental powers of the [territory](/usc/48/2104.md?p=20) or [territorial instrumentality](/usc/48/2104.md?p=19-A), including expenditures for such exercise, but whether or not a case has been or can be commenced under this subchapter—

- (1) a [territory](/usc/48/2104.md?p=20) law prescribing a method of composition of indebtedness or a moratorium law, but solely to the extent that it prohibits the payment of principal or interest by an entity not described in [section 109(b)(2) of title 11](/usc/11/109.md?p=b-2), may not bind any creditor of a [covered territory](/usc/48/2104.md?p=8) or any [covered territorial instrumentality](/usc/48/2104.md?p=7) thereof that does not consent to the composition or moratorium;
- (2) a judgment entered under a law described in [paragraph (1)](#1) may not bind a creditor that does not consent to the composition; and
- (3) unlawful executive orders that alter, amend, or modify rights of holders of any debt of the [territory](/usc/48/2104.md?p=20) or [territorial instrumentality](/usc/48/2104.md?p=19-A), or that divert funds from one [territorial instrumentality](/usc/48/2104.md?p=19-A) to another or to the [territory](/usc/48/2104.md?p=20), shall be preempted by this chapter.

## Source credit

(Pub. L. 114–187, title III, § 303, June 30, 2016, 130 Stat. 579.)

### References in Text

This chapter, referred to in par. (3), was in the original “this Act”, meaning Pub. L. 114–187, June 30, 2016, 130 Stat. 549, known as the Puerto Rico Oversight, Management, and Economic Stability Act and also as PROMESA, which is classified principally to this chapter. For complete classification of this Act to the Code, see Short Title note set out under section 2101 of this title and Tables.
